    I have the Sargent Touring seat on my F8GS with the standard material and black welt. If I could do it again, I'd get it without the welt. That's what I did on my 1200RT and it looks much better IMO. Just keep in mind that the no-welt option is "non-standard" and therefore the seat would be subject to a 10% restock fee if you decided to return it for a refund.
